解锁AI潜能:从入门到精通的实用指南

解锁AI潜能:从入门到精通的实用指南

一、技术入门:AI开发的核心架构解析

当前AI开发已形成以Transformer为核心的技术生态,其自注意力机制(Self-Attention)彻底改变了自然语言处理(NLP)和计算机视觉(CV)的底层逻辑。最新发布的Multi-Head Projection Attention(MHPA)通过动态权重分配机制,在保持参数量不变的情况下将推理速度提升37%,成为替代传统注意力机制的新选择。

1.1 开发环境搭建指南

  • 硬件配置:推荐使用NVIDIA A100 80GB或AMD MI250X GPU,配合PCIe 4.0总线实现数据高速传输。对于边缘计算场景,Jetson AGX Orin开发者套件提供275TOPS算力支持
  • 软件栈:PyTorch 2.5与TensorFlow 3.0成为主流选择,前者在动态图执行方面优势明显,后者在分布式训练稳定性上更胜一筹。建议新手从PyTorch Lightning框架入手,其简洁的API设计可降低70%的样板代码量
  • 数据管道:采用HuggingFace Datasets库构建标准化数据流,配合Dask实现TB级数据的高效加载。最新推出的DataLoader Pro工具通过内存映射技术,将数据预处理速度提升至每秒12万样本

1.2 模型选择矩阵

任务类型 推荐模型 参数量 推理延迟
文本生成 GPT-4 Turbo 1.8T 320ms/token
图像分类 ConvNeXt V3 2.1B 8.2ms/img
多模态 Flamingo-2 90B 145ms/query

二、性能对比:主流框架深度评测

在最新MLPerf基准测试中,PyTorch与TensorFlow在训练效率上呈现显著分化。使用ResNet-50模型进行ImageNet训练时,TensorFlow的混合精度训练策略使其吞吐量达到58,000 images/sec,较PyTorch高出19%。但在NLP任务中,PyTorch的动态图机制使BERT训练速度领先23%。

2.1 推理优化方案

  1. 量化技术:采用FP8混合精度量化可将模型体积压缩4倍,配合NVIDIA TensorRT的动态量化校准,在保持99.2%准确率的前提下实现3.8倍加速
  2. 剪枝策略:结构化剪枝比非结构化剪枝更具工程实用性,最新提出的Channel Importance Estimation(CIE)算法可自动识别冗余通道,在ResNet-18上实现75%参数量裁剪且精度损失仅0.8%
  3. 蒸馏方法:知识蒸馏进入3.0时代,基于对比学习的Contrastive Distillation框架使教师模型的知识迁移效率提升40%,学生模型在CIFAR-100上的准确率达到96.3%

2.2 硬件加速对比

在TPU v4与A100的对比测试中,前者在矩阵运算密集型任务(如Transformer训练)中展现出绝对优势,单芯片性能达到260TFLOPS。但A100的第三代Tensor Core在稀疏运算加速上更胜一筹,特别适合处理剪枝后的模型。对于边缘设备,高通AI Engine与苹果Neural Engine形成双雄格局,前者在移动端NLP推理速度上领先12%,后者在图像处理能效比上具有优势。

三、使用技巧:突破开发瓶颈的10个关键方法

3.1 数据工程最佳实践

  • 采用Progressive Resampling策略处理类别不平衡问题,在训练过程中动态调整样本权重,使模型对长尾数据的识别准确率提升27%
  • 利用Synthetic Data Augmentation(SDA)技术生成对抗样本,在医疗影像分类任务中使模型鲁棒性提高41%
  • 构建自动化数据清洗管道,通过Confidence-based Filtering移除低质量标注样本,在COCO数据集上使mAP提升3.2个百分点

3.2 训练加速秘籍

  1. 使用Gradient Checkpointing技术将显存占用降低65%,使10B参数模型可在单张A100上训练
  2. 采用ZeRO-3优化器实现参数、梯度、优化器状态的分布式存储,在千亿参数模型训练中使通信开销减少58%
  3. 应用Dynamic Batching策略自动调整批次大小,在变长序列处理任务中使GPU利用率稳定在92%以上

3.3 部署优化方案

在移动端部署时,采用Neural Architecture Search(NAS)自动生成硬件适配模型,可使iPhone 15上的CoreML推理速度达到120FPS。对于Web端应用,WebAssembly与WebGL的混合渲染方案将模型加载时间缩短至1.2秒,较纯JavaScript实现快5.7倍。在服务端部署方面,ONNX Runtime的图优化技术使AWS p4d实例的吞吐量达到每秒18万次推理。

四、未来展望:下一代AI技术趋势

神经符号系统(Neural-Symbolic Systems)正在突破纯连接主义的局限,最新提出的DeepProbLog框架将概率逻辑编程与深度学习结合,在知识推理任务中取得突破性进展。光子芯片与存算一体架构的发展预示着AI硬件将进入光子计算时代,Lightmatter公司的Mars芯片已实现16TOPS/W的能效比,较传统GPU提升两个数量级。

在伦理与安全领域,可解释AI(XAI)进入实用化阶段,Concept Activation Vectors(CAV)技术可定量分析模型决策依据,在金融风控场景中使模型可解释性评分达到0.87(满分1.0)。差分隐私与联邦学习的结合催生出Secure Aggregation 2.0协议,在医疗数据共享中实现ε=1的隐私保护强度。